Picture This: in PDFs, All Over Your Site, Images Matter

Ah, pity the poor alt tag. I have championed the little bit of code for years. And the hard-working descriptors still matter.

But not as much as the images themselves.

Google's been busy (< anyone want to nominate that for shocking headline of the year?) updating its image search protocols this summer. Among other things, the search superhero is now pulling images out of .pdfs and indexing them too!

Anyway, the good news for me and my oft-overlooked alt tags is they're still mighty important.
